Transaction 12c65843f74183c6dcb5ad08146dcd8a316ca68d120a6b98aab7d41e96e3b665
1 Input
1 Output
-
12c65843f74183c6dcb5ad08146dcd8a316ca68d120a6b98aab7d41e96e3b665:0
- value
- 70114254
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4884d8c72fe56aea929806716ae76198310144df O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cSoAmwvAuMAHJQjW4mHynf3MwVfN2TTx